How We Can Help

Individual advising appointments are tailored to a student’s needs and questions. Common topics discussed in individual appointments include but are not limited to:

  • Deciding whether law school is the best fit to reach your goals.
  • Understanding the impact of your LSAT score and academic record (including GPA) on the likelihood of your admission to law school.
  • Reviewing and providing feedback on draft documents for submission with law school applications including personal statements, addenda and résumés.
  • Selecting a list of schools, or refining your list of law schools for application based on your criteria for evaluating schools and each schools’ past admissions criteria.
  • Understanding law school financing and comparing offers from multiple law schools.
